## Local Setup

Welcome to MarkForge, our markdown rendering pipeline. Since you're reviewing the sanitizer, you'll want the full stack running locally: clone the repo, run `make bootstrap`, and start the renderer worker with `make worker`. The sanitizer config lives in `config/scrub.yaml` — that's where the allowlist of HTML tags is defined, so give it a hard look. Rendered output and audit logs are persisted to a local Postgres instance. Point the app at that database with the connection string below.

replica DSN, tawef-hahap: mysql://eliix_svc:FiIC0jz@db-394a.lumiclabs.internal:5432/holius

## Changelog — Pathloom deep-link router v4.2

Defaults changed. Unmatched links now fall back to the home screen instead of the web view. Universal-link validation is on by default; unsigned routes are rejected. Retry on cold-start resolution dropped from 3 to 1. Contractors: update local builds before testing. The new default routing configuration shipped with 4.2 is as follows:

service settings:
[casax]
port = 6379
team = rusir
host = casax.zemvarhq.corp
region = outer-4
access_code = ac_9808ce
timeout_ms = 1500

## Formula sandbox tuning

User-supplied formulas in Gridmoor execute inside a restricted interpreter with hard ceilings on time, memory, and call depth. Reviewers should confirm any change to these ceilings is justified in the PR description, since raising them widens the abuse surface. Defaults were chosen from production traces. The current limits are as follows.

limits module of tafog-fawip:
WEIGHTS = {
    "julix": 57,
    "lamys": 992,
    "kasvan": 209,
    "quenok": 750,
    "alddor": 259,
    "oliath": 1009,
    "wenix": 815,
}

Handover for the contractor: we're replacing the homegrown Pipewheel job queue with Corvid. Producers are already dual-writing; consumers still read from Pipewheel only. Your job: flip consumers service by service, billing last. Dedup is handled by Corvid's idempotency keys — don't re-add the old hash check. Rollback is a single env toggle per service. Old queue gets decommissioned two weeks after the last flip. Corvid workers run with this configuration.

deployment values, faduf-tawep:
SORDOR_LOG_LEVEL=error
SORDOR_METRICS_HOST=metrics.sordor.nelvrolabs.internal
SORDOR_POOL_SIZE=4